1992 BMW M3 vs. 2008 Ascari A10

To start off, 2008 Ascari A10 is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 BMW M3.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 BMW M3 would be higher. At 4,941 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Ascari A10 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Ascari A10 (625 HP @ 7500 RPM) has 343 more horse power than 1992 BMW M3. (282 HP @ 7000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Ascari A10 should accelerate faster than 1992 BMW M3.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1992 BMW M3 weights approximately 185 kg more than 2008 Ascari A10.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Ascari A10 (560 Nm @ 5500 RPM) has 240 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 BMW M3. (320 Nm @ 3400 RPM). This means 2008 Ascari A10 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 BMW M3.

Compare all specifications:

1992 BMW M3 2008 Ascari A10
Make BMW Ascari
Model M3 A10
Year Released 1992 2008
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 2990 cc 4941 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 282 HP 625 HP
Engine RPM 7000 RPM 7500 RPM
Torque 320 Nm 560 Nm
Torque RPM 3400 RPM 5500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 86 mm 94 mm
Engine Stroke Size 85.8 mm 89 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.8:1 11.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 1465 kg 1280 kg
Vehicle Length 4440 mm 4300 mm
Vehicle Width 1710 mm 1852 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1138 mm
Wheelbase Size 2710 mm 2636 mm
